76e4034e01 path linkify: server attaches file_refs at message ingest
drop the /api/state-file/check probe endpoint (which let any
dashboard visitor enumerate filesystem layout by feeding paths)
and the client's optimistic-then-downgrade dance. instead, the
broker forwarder calls scan_validated_paths(body) — same
allow-list helper as the read endpoint — and attaches the
verified file tokens to DashboardEvent::Sent/Delivered as
file_refs: Vec<String>. /dashboard/history backfill does the
same per-row.

client appendLinkified takes a (text, refs) pair, walks
left-to-right linkifying every occurrence of any ref token,
longest-first tie-break. no regex, no probe, no cache, no
queue. when refs is empty/absent the body emits as plain text
(question/answer/reminder rendering — refs for those are a
follow-up).

operator inbox stores file_refs from the sent event so its
renderer gets the same anchors as the message-flow terminal.

- **Split harness-internal state from agent-visible state**: the `/agents/<n>/state/` mount (host `/var/lib/hyperhive/agents/<n>/state/`) currently mixes the agent's durable notes with harness internals — `hyperhive-events.sqlite`, `hyperhive-turn-stats.sqlite`, `hyperhive-model`, future per-agent skill caches, etc. The agent can accidentally overwrite a harness file, the harness clutters what claude thinks is "my notes dir", and the host-side vacuum has to special-case filenames it owns. Move harness internals to a sibling dir, e.g. `/var/lib/hyperhive/agents/<n>/harness/`, bind-mounted RW into the container as `/agents/<n>/harness/` (same path inside + out, same convention as state). Container's `/agents/<n>/state/` becomes purely agent-owned. Touches: `paths.rs` (new `harness_dir()`), `events.rs`, `turn_stats.rs` (default paths flip), `events_vacuum.rs` (sweep root flips), `lifecycle.rs` (extra bind mount), and a migration that moves existing files on first boot under the new layout. Side benefit: makes the privsep TODO cheaper — the unprivileged web server only needs read access to `/agents/<n>/state/` (operator-meaningful files), not `/agents/<n>/harness/`. The legacy bare `/state` mount the manager still uses (`container_state_prefix("manager") == "/state/"`, manager bind in `lifecycle::set_nspawn_flags`) gets removed in the same pass — manager goes to `/agents/manager/state/` + `/agents/manager/harness/` like every other agent.

/// Scan `body` for path-shaped tokens, validate each against the
/// allow-list, return the unique set of tokens that resolve to a
/// regular file. Called at broker-message ingest time so the
/// dashboard event already carries the verified set — no client-
/// side probe endpoint required, and historical messages get the
/// same treatment on `/dashboard/history` backfill.
///
/// Tokenisation: split on whitespace + a handful of trailing
/// punctuation chars (`,;:)]}`) that commonly follow paths in
/// natural-language text but aren't part of the path itself. Any
/// token starting with `/agents/`, `/shared/`, or
/// `/var/lib/hyperhive/{agents,shared}/` is a candidate. The
/// allow-list + is_file check happens via the same
/// `resolve_state_path` helper the read endpoint uses, so the
/// security rules can't drift.
pub(crate) fn scan_validated_paths(body: &str) -> Vec<String> {
const PREFIXES: [&str; 4] = [
"/agents/",
"/shared/",
"/var/lib/hyperhive/agents/",
"/var/lib/hyperhive/shared/",
];
let mut out = Vec::<String>::new();
for raw in body.split(|c: char| c.is_whitespace()) {
// Trim trailing natural-language punctuation that wouldn't
// be part of any real path. Inline rather than via a regex
// dep — the set is small and the call is hot.
let token = raw.trim_end_matches(|c: char| matches!(c, ',' | ';' | ':' | ')' | ']' | '}' | '.' | '\'' | '"'));
if token.is_empty() {
continue;
}
if !PREFIXES.iter().any(|p| token.starts_with(p)) {
continue;
}
// Cheap dedupe — typical message has 0-3 refs.
if out.iter().any(|s| s == token) {
continue;
}
if let Ok(canonical) = resolve_state_path(token) {
if std::fs::metadata(&canonical).is_ok_and(|m| m.is_file()) {
out.push(token.to_owned());
}
}
}
out
}
